ALEXANDRIA, Va., Sept. 30 -- United States Patent no. 12,429,999, issued on Sept. 30, was assigned to Procore Technologies Inc. (Carpinteria, Calif.).
"Mobile viewer object statusing" was invented by Kevin McKee (Del Mar, Calif.) and David McCool (Carpinteria, Calif.).
